PPC (Pay-Per-Click) Specialist – Contractor Position – 1099
We’re hiring for our PPC team and looking for a skilled, well-rounded, mid-career digital PPC SEM marketer (minimum 3-5 years experience) to focus on billable client work for PPC programs.
Liquid Spark is a specialized, intimate agency—a team of 9 people and counting – with a flexible, entrepreneurial work environment, no stuffy hierarchies, and career advancement as big as your vision. If you want to drive to an impressive agency office building, or just to keep your head down and be a task doer, we are not for you.
A benefit of our size is that we reward entrepreneurial people who take initiative—we want you to propose (and execute) the smart ideas your past boss or colleagues kept ignoring. You’ll be working with senior management and owners at passionate client adventure companies, not locked in a cubicle with no client contact.
We’re a 100% remote team based across the USA. One of our digital nomads currently works from Europe. Our original headquarters is in Bryson City, NC, in the Smoky Mountains, where the company was founded. Some of us move around and work from different places during the year. The only requirement is demonstrating that you have high speed internet access wherever you work.
Our mission is to create practical marketing that inspires adventure, action, and stewardship of people, place, and planet. We’re proud to be a One Percent for the Planet company.
The Liquid Spark PPC Specialist contractor role supports strategy and weekly management, optimization, and new campaign setup of client PPC programs. The PPC Specialist works closely with the account team, reports to the Director of Operations, and has direct access to the President. While the majority of the work is done behind the scenes, this role works directly with clients as needed for check-ins, team meetings and information sharing for PPC programs.
Compensation
Competitive hourly contractor wages, based on experience. Current range is $50-70/hour.
This is a year-round position. Approximate number of hours/week is 5-10 hours, with some seasonality for peak tourism season and off season.Total time includes client billable time and limited Liquid Spark administrative time in team meetings, etc.
